13.12.2012, 05:12 | #11 (permalink) |
Member
Регистрация: 09.12.2012
Сообщений: 45
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
|
|
13.12.2012, 05:12 | |
Helpmaster
Member
Регистрация: 08.03.2016
Сообщений: 0
|
Лучше сразу прояснить ситуацию прочитав схожие посты Строки в Паскаль Паскаль, строки Строки. Паскаль Паскаль. Строки Строки, Паскаль Паскаль, символы и строки |
13.12.2012, 09:36 | #12 (permalink) | |
Специалист
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
|
Цитата:
Пятую строку снизу if Max=A[i] then b:=false; исправьте на if Max=A[j] then b:=false; |
|
14.12.2012, 10:19 | #15 (permalink) |
Специалист
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
|
|
Ads | |
Member
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
|
14.12.2012, 11:08 | #17 (permalink) |
Специалист
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
|
Код:
Var S:String; A:Array [1..255] of Byte; i,j,N:Byte; Code:Integer; Max:Byte; b:boolean; Begin Writeln('Enter the string:'); Readln(S); N:=0; i:=0; Repeat repeat Inc(i); until ((Ord(S[i])>47) and (Ord(S[i])<58)) or (i>=Length(S)); If i<=Length(S) then begin Inc(N); Val(S[i],A[N],Code); end; Until i>=Length(S); Max:=A[1]; For i:=2 to N do If A[i]>Max then Max:=A[i]; Repeat b:=true; Dec(Max); for j:=1 to N do if Max=A[j] then b:=false; Until b or (Max=0); If b then Writeln('Result: ',Max) else Writeln('No such figure'); Readln; End. |
14.12.2012, 11:56 | #18 (permalink) |
Member
Регистрация: 14.12.2012
Сообщений: 13
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
|
Оуу Владимир, спасибо!! не ожидал такого быстрого ответа
|
Ads | |
Member
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
|
Опции темы | |
Опции просмотра | |
|
|